首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> .NET > VB Dotnet >

在DataGridView删除一行好如何保存

2012-10-10 
在DataGridView删除一行好怎么保存DataGridView1.Rows.Remove(DataGridView1.CurrentRow)我前面的数据库连

在DataGridView删除一行好怎么保存


  DataGridView1.Rows.Remove(DataGridView1.CurrentRow)





我前面的数据库连接是这样的怎么修改进来
  Dim number As Integer
  number = ListView1.Items.IndexOf(ListView1.FocusedItem) ''获取选中项的索引号
Dim str As String = ListView1.Items(number).SubItems(3).Text ''记录选中项的第四列(配送人员)的值 Dim querystring As String = "delete * from 配送数据库 where 配送人员 = '" & str & "'"
  Dim conn As New OleDb.OleDbConnection(connectionstring)
  Try
  conn.Open()
  Dim cmd As New OleDb.OleDbCommand(querystring, conn)
  cmd.ExecuteNonQuery() ''执行删除命令
  ListView1.Items(number).Remove() ''删除ListView1中选中的记录 MsgBox("删除选中记录!")
  Catch ex As Exception
  MsgBox(ex.Message)
  End Try
  End Sub

[解决办法]
删除的一行,有一特别的标志(一般用记录的ID,或身份证号。。。,只要不重复)

根据这一标志在表中删除记录(或在记录集中删除)

再刷新DataGridView1

热点排行